Forget oysters. These fall foods make for steamier sex—so stock up.

They look weird, smell funny, and without fail you pass them up at every holiday dinner. But as much as you love to hate Brussels sprouts, these little green veggies could give you a boost in the bedroom. They contain a compound called indole-3-carbinol, which reduces estrogen and spikes libido in men. A bonus: “Current research is showing promise in the area of prevention and lowering cancer risk with increased consumption of cruciferous vegetables and therefore Indole-3-carbinol,” says Adiana Castro, R.D.

